Chinese GPU manufacturer Moore Threads is set to list in Hong Kong after reporting a remarkable 147% increase in revenue for the first half of the year. This move marks a significant milestone for the company as it seeks to expand its footprint in the competitive tech market.

Moore Threads Eyes Hong Kong Listing

In a significant development for the tech industry, Chinese graphics processing unit (GPU) manufacturer Moore Threads has announced plans to pursue a listing in Hong Kong. This strategic move comes on the heels of the company's impressive financial performance, with a staggering 147% increase in revenue during the first half of the year.

Strong Financial Performance

Moore Threads, founded in 2020, has rapidly emerged as a key player in the GPU market, particularly in China. The company's revenue growth reflects its successful efforts to cater to the increasing demand for high-performance graphics solutions in various sectors, including gaming, artificial intelligence, and data centers. The 147% surge in revenue signals not just robust sales but also a growing acceptance of its products in a market traditionally dominated by international giants.
